Loft, this looks really good. The hole placement there is Ok because it is in front of the short electrode and the hole is over that.

I can see that the wick is not really eps earned at all. This can take a day or two, but there is a shortcut :)

Put a fresh battery in the katana and put the fill screw back in. Tilt the katana nearly completely upside down then press the button and hold it. If the coil glows too hot put a drop or two of juice on it to keep it from overheating and popping.

Keep doing this for a minute or two. You will notice that suddenly the wick will start pulling juice very very fast. Faster than the coil can burn it off, it will literally start acting like a straw full of holes when it's time to stop.

At this point, let go of the button and tilt it back up. Your wick and coil should be almost completely "seasoned" at this point. Put the cap back on and test it. Your wicking issues should be a corrected and you should be blowing nice thick clouds of flavorful vapor.

I have the iAtty too and it never gets used. You will find that the wick in your Genisis will last you months, not days without needing to be replaced.

Depending on the juice you use and your vaping style you will eventually see the coil will get good and gummed up with carbon sludge (just like the iAtty).

The difference is that to clean the katana, all you will need to do is dry burn the coil till it gets food and hot and while it is glowing, run the coil under therapy or dunk it in a cup or cold water. The crud will jump right off the coil. Dry it up and do it a couple more times. The coil will be almost like new except for the nice "seasoning" you worked onto it during the initial break-in period.

Dry it off and fill it back up and you are ready to go another few weeks to a couple of months with no maintenance other than occasionally wiping out condensation from the top cap.

The Genisis is a different world than other rebuildables and I am sure you will get a lot of enjoyment from it :)
